How much do quality system j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for quality system in Decatur, GA is $25.03,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$21.83 and $28.17 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Quality System jobs?

Quality System jobs involve developing, implementing, and maintaining the processes and standards that ensure a company’s products or services meet regulatory and customer requirements. Professionals in these roles often work with quality management systems (QMS), conduct audits, and ensure compliance with industry regulations like ISO standards. They play a key role in continuous improvement by identifying areas for enhancement and working with other teams to resolve quality-related issues. Quality System jobs are vital across industries such as manufacturing, healthcare, and pharmaceuticals to guarantee product safety, reliability, and effectiveness.

What is the difference between Quality System vs Quality Assurance?

AspectQuality SystemQuality Assurance
DefinitionFramework of policies, processes, and procedures to ensure quality management across an organization.Part of the quality system focused on preventing defects through planned activities and systematic processes.
FocusOverall quality management and compliancePreventing defects and ensuring product/service quality
CertificationsISO 9001, QS-9000ISO 9001, Six Sigma, CQA
Work EnvironmentCross-departmental, organizational-wideSpecific to quality processes and audits

In summary, a Quality System encompasses the entire framework for managing quality within an organization, including policies and procedures. Quality Assurance is a key component of the Quality System, focusing specifically on preventing defects and ensuring quality through systematic activities.

SUMMARY The quality Manager's primary directive involves coordinating activities both internally and externally as related to the meeting of customer's expectations.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

  1. Formulates and maintains quality assurance objectives to corporate policies and goals.
  2. Coordinates TS16949 quality system documentation, maintenance and follow-up for the facility.
  3. Investigates and addresses customer complaints regarding quality through CAR's
  4. Reviews test and inspection reports; directs corrective action to be taken in cases of non-conforming material
  5. Ensures that complete records on quality issues are maintained with specifications and manuals are up to date.
  6. Suggests and debates alternative methods and procedures in solving problems.
  7. Analyzes statistical data and product specifications to determine present standards and establish proposed quality and reliability of finished product
  8. Maintains a working knowledge of government and industry quality assurance codes and standards.
  9. This position is required to work daily and weekend overtime and to travel.
  10.  Other duties as required.
  11. Understand BIC Key performance indicators and develop and implement corrective actions to meet or exceed BIC 75
  12. Drive lean principles to reduce waste and implement 5S and Kaizens in department
  13. Manage Quality Department including Quality Engineer and Quality Supervisor
  14. Ensure good communication across shifts, departments
  15. Participate in problem solving, VSM, Kaizen projects
  16. Implement SOT's, standard work
  17. Audit for standard work, quality, understanding HSE
  18. Train, disqualify, qualify and audit performance on teammates

S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ES This position has 5 subordinate employees
